A propriedade CSS3 que permite controlar o que deve acontece...

Próximas questões
Com base no mesmo assunto
Q2098325 Programação
A propriedade CSS3 que permite controlar o que deve acontecer com um conteúdo grande demais para caber em uma área, ou recortando ou adicionando barras de rolagem nessa área, é a propriedade
Alternativas

Gabarito comentado

Confira o gabarito comentado por um dos nossos professores

Gabarito: Letra B - overflow

Para entender o motivo pelo qual a alternativa B é a correta, vamos discorrer sobre a propriedade overflow do CSS. Esta propriedade é utilizada para controlar o comportamento de conteúdos que não cabem dentro de um elemento HTML. Quando o conteúdo de um elemento é maior do que o espaço disponível, o CSS oferece algumas opções para o gerenciamento desse excesso através da propriedade overflow. As opções mais comuns são 'hidden' (oculta o conteúdo excedente), 'scroll' (adiciona barras de rolagem ao elemento para que o conteúdo excedente possa ser acessado), 'auto' (aplica barras de rolagem apenas quando necessário) e 'visible' (o conteúdo excedente é mostrado fora do elemento).

Por que a alternativa B está correta? De todas as opções apresentadas, somente a propriedade overflow é responsável por determinar como um conteúdo que não cabe em seu contêiner deve ser apresentado. Seja permitindo a rolagem, cortando o conteúdo excedente ou até mesmo permitindo que ele flua para fora do contêiner, o overflow é a ferramenta correta para esse tipo de controle.

As outras alternativas não se aplicam ao contexto da questão:

  • float é usada para posicionar elementos ao lado um do outro;
  • scrollbar, apesar de estar relacionada às barras de rolagem, não é propriamente uma propriedade CSS, mas sim parte dos elementos de interação do usuário com a página;
  • content-weight não é uma propriedade existente em CSS;
  • e stretch também não é uma propriedade CSS aplicável neste contexto.

Portanto, o conhecimento sobre a propriedade overflow e suas funcionalidades é essencial para a resolução correta da questão apresentada.

Clique para visualizar este gabarito

Visualize o gabarito desta questão clicando no botão abaixo

Comentários

Veja os comentários dos nossos alunos

Resposta: B

Estouro de CSS

A overflow propriedade especifica se deve cortar o conteúdo ou adicionar barras de rolagem quando o conteúdo de um elemento for muito grande para caber na área especificada.

A overflow propriedade tem os seguintes valores:

visible- Padrão. O estouro não é cortado. O conteúdo renderiza fora da caixa do elemento

hidden- O estouro é cortado e o restante do conteúdo ficará invisível

scroll- O estouro é cortado e uma barra de rolagem é adicionada para ver o restante do conteúdo

auto- Semelhante ao scroll, mas adiciona barras de rolagem somente quando necessário

https://www.w3schools.com/css/css_overflow.asp#

propriedade CSS3 que permite controlar o que deve acontecer com um conteúdo grande demais para caber em uma área é a propriedade overflow. Essa propriedade tem quatro valores possíveis:

Introdução a CSS3

O CSS3 (Cascading Style Sheets 3) trouxe várias melhorias e novas propriedades para estilizar páginas web, permitindo maior controle sobre o layout e o comportamento de elementos em uma página. Uma das propriedades importantes para o controle do conteúdo dentro de um container é a propriedade overflow, que determina como o conteúdo que excede o tamanho de um elemento deve ser tratado. Essa propriedade pode ser usada para controlar o comportamento visual de um conteúdo que não se ajusta completamente dentro de sua área de exibição, oferecendo opções para ocultar o excesso, adicionar barras de rolagem ou exibir o conteúdo de maneira diferente.

Resolução

Vamos analisar cada alternativa em relação à propriedade que controla o que acontece com um conteúdo grande demais para caber em uma área:

Letra A, está errada. A propriedade float é usada para posicionar elementos ao lado de outros, permitindo que o conteúdo flua ao redor de um elemento, como uma imagem. Ela não tem relação com o controle do conteúdo que ultrapassa os limites de um container.

Letra B, está correta. A propriedade overflow é a que controla o comportamento de um conteúdo que é maior do que o espaço disponível em um elemento. Ela pode ter valores como visible (onde o conteúdo é exibido fora da área), hidden (onde o conteúdo é cortado), scroll (onde barras de rolagem são adicionadas), e auto (onde as barras de rolagem aparecem apenas se necessário).

Letra C, está errada. Não existe uma propriedade CSS chamada scrollbar. Embora as barras de rolagem possam ser adicionadas usando a propriedade overflow, não há uma propriedade específica chamada scrollbar para esse fim.

Letra D, está errada. A propriedade content-weight não existe no CSS. A terminologia correta para o controle do conteúdo de elementos é overflow, como mencionado na alternativa correta.

Letra E, está errada. A propriedade stretch não existe no contexto de controle de conteúdo que excede uma área. Ela pode ser confundida com o valor stretch utilizado em outras propriedades, como no controle de flexbox, mas não se aplica à questão do controle de conteúdo grande demais para caber em uma área.

Resposta: B - Chatgpt

Clique para visualizar este comentário

Visualize os comentários desta questão clicando no botão abaixo